The Superpowers of Neurodivergent Game Developers with Autism and ADHD

“When we stop viewing autism and ADHD through a lens of deficit and start viewing them as unique cognitive frameworks, we unlock an unprecedented wave of creative and analytical potential in game design.”

To understand why neurodivergent game developers with autism and ADHD excel in this field, we must look at how their brains process information. Game development is a multidisciplinary art form. It requires a rare mix of rigid logic (coding, debugging, systems design) and boundless imagination (world-building, storytelling, character design).

Neurodivergent individuals often possess a combination of traits that align perfectly with these demands:

1. The Power of Hyperfocus

For individuals with ADHD and autism, “hyperfocus” is not just a buzzword; it is a profound state of cognitive flow. When deeply interested in a subject, a neurodivergent developer can concentrate on a highly complex task—such as writing clean C# code or fine-tuning character physics—for hours without distraction. This ability to enter “the zone” allows for rapid skill acquisition and high-volume productivity. Organizations like the ADHD Foundation advocate for recognizing these intense focus states as major assets in technical and creative careers.

2. Advanced Pattern Thinking and Systemization

Autistic individuals often exhibit a highly developed ability to recognize patterns, categorize information, and understand complex systems. In game development, everything is a system. From the game loop that dictates how a player moves, to the economy of an in-game market, to the branching pathways of a narrative tree—it all relies on systematic logic. Pattern thinkers can visualize these systems in their entirety, anticipating bugs and structural flaws before they even manifest in the code.

3. Systems Creativity and Out-of-the-Box Problem Solving

Because neurodivergent minds do not always follow conventional cognitive pathways, their approach to problem-solving is inherently innovative. Where a neurotypical developer might see a standard solution to a level-design bottleneck, an ADHD or autistic developer might invent an entirely new gameplay mechanic to bypass the issue. This “systems creativity” is what leads to indie game sensations—games that subvert expectations and introduce mechanics players have never experienced before. Bridging the Gap: Neurodiversity in the Tech Workforce

“The tech industry is beginning to realize that neurodiversity is not a compliance metric to be met, but a competitive advantage that drives technological breakthroughs.”

The modern tech workforce is undergoing a massive cultural shift. Historically, recruitment processes and workplace environments were designed exclusively for neurotypical individuals, often shutting out highly capable talent due to overwhelming sensory environments or non-traditional social communication styles.

Today, the tide is turning. Major tech employers are actively launching neurodiversity hiring initiatives, recognizing that a significant portion of the tech workforce identifies as neurodivergent. In the gaming sector specifically, organizations like the International Game Developers Association (IGDA) are championing accessibility, diversity, and inclusion, ensuring that studios provide the sensory-friendly environments and flexible workflows that allow neurodivergent creators to thrive.

Despite this progress, a gap remains. Many neurodivergent teens with a passion for gaming struggle in traditional educational settings. Standard computer science classrooms can be sensory-heavy, socially stressful, or rigidly paced, causing bright students to disengage. To build a robust pipeline of neurodivergent game developers with autism and ADHD, we must start earlier—providing specialized, supportive, and engaging learning environments during their formative teenage years.
